From New York Times bestselling
author of Eyes
That Kiss in the Corners, Joanna Ho, and critically acclaimed illustrator,
Cátia Chien comes a moving, powerful picture book
about the life and work of activist and artist, Ai Weiwei.

He [Ai Weiwei] felt the life jackets
and an idea curled and crested through his fingertips.
The way it always did.


Told in Joanna Ho’s signature lyrical writing, this is the
story that shines a light on Ai Weiwei and his
journey, specifically how the Life Jackets exhibit at Konzerthaus
Berlin came to be. As conditions for refugees worsened, Ai Weiwei
was inspired by the discarded life jackets on the shores of Lesbos
to create a bold installation that would grab the attention
of the world.


Cátia Chien masterfully portrays the intricate life of
Ai Weiwei with inspirations from woodblock printing and a special
emphasis on the colour orange, the same colour of the life jackets
that became a beacon of hope. Through Cátia’s
dynamic and stunning illustrations, we see how Ai Weiwei
became the activist and artist he is today while proving the
power of art within humanity.
